共用方式為


ITCallInfo::SetCallInfoBuffer 方法 (tapi3if.h)

SetCallInfoBuffer方法會設定需要緩衝區的呼叫資訊專案,例如使用者使用者資訊。 自動化用戶端應用程式,例如以 Visual Basic 撰寫的用戶端應用程式,必須使用 ITCallInfo::p ut_CallInfoBuffer 方法。

語法

HRESULT SetCallInfoBuffer(
  [in] CALLINFO_BUFFER CallInfoBuffer,
  [in] DWORD           dwSize,
  [in] BYTE            *pCallInfoBuffer
);

參數

[in] CallInfoBuffer

CALLINFO_BUFFER 所需的資訊類型指標,例如CIB_USERUSERINFO。

[in] dwSize

pCallInfoBuffer的大小。

[in] pCallInfoBuffer

呼叫資訊緩衝區的指標。

傳回值

這個方法可以傳回其中一個值。

傳回碼 描述
S_OK
方法成功。
E_OUTOFMEMORY
記憶體不足,無法執行作業。
E_POINTER
pCallInfoBuffer參數不是有效的指標。
E_INVALIDARG
CallInfoBuffer參數不是有效的值。
TAPI_E_INVALCALLSTATE
目前的 撥號狀態 對這項作業無效。

需求

   
目標平台 Windows
標頭 tapi3if.h (包括 Tapi3.h)
程式庫 Uuid.lib
Dll Tapi3.dll

另請參閱

CALLINFO_BUFFER

Call 物件

GetCallInfoBuffer

ITCallInfo

get_CallInfoBuffer

put_CallInfoBuffer